Make the most of your summer with fun actvities from Country Kids pediatric occupational therapist Molly Markland:
- Walk on your tip toes all the way around the house.
- Draw a line with chalk and try to walk on it like a balance beam.
- Put on a button down shirt, and practice buttoning and unbuttoning the shirt.
- Try and do 10 push-ups, 10 sit-ups and 10 jumping jacks.
- Draw a picture of where you live.
- Play hide and seek with a grown up.
- Play jump rope.
- Play catch with a big wet sponge.
- Practice writing your name; make it more fun by doing it with chalk on the driveway.
